What Was Mark Harmon’s Role in NCIS?

Mark Harmon, who portrayed Leroy Jethro Gibbs, commanded the spotlight as the Supervisory Special Agent at NCIS from Seasons 1 to 19.

NCIS, the CBS procedural drama, portrays the lives of special agents in the Major Case Response Team of the Naval Criminal Investigation Service, tackling criminal cases involving the United States Navy, Marine Corps, and their loved ones.

In a February 2023 interview with Entertainment Tonight, Wilmer Valderrama, who expertly portrayed NCIS Special Agent Nicholas Torres since Season 14, acknowledged Harmon’s instrumental role in guiding NCIS from its inception.

Valderrama shed light on the show’s remarkable journey, paying homage to the exceptional actors. Some actors remain part of the ensemble, while others left their mark as memorable guest stars.

Valderrama emphasized NCIS’s significant impact on its fan base and the entertainment industry, serving as a beacon of opportunity and inspiration for aspiring actors.

Valderrama expressed deep admiration for Mark Harmon, recognizing his commitment to maintaining the show’s integrity and core values.

With a milestone of 450 episodes, Valderrama humbly acknowledged that they couldn’t claim credit for the first 300 episodes but relished the opportunity to stand on the same hallowed ground as the esteemed NCIS team.

Why Did Mark Harmon Leave NCIS?

Mark Harmon’s departure from NCIS was prompted by a desire to revive his career. Harmon decided to remain in Alaska rather than return to Washington D.C. and continue his career with NCIS.

Gibbs expressed a sense of peace he hadn’t felt since the death of his wife and daughter and decided to follow his instincts. He offered his position at NCIS to Senior Field Agent Timothy McGee, acknowledging his unwavering support.

In interviews, Harmon discussed the character’s trajectory reaching a natural turning point and the need to keep the role fresh and challenging.

He also mentioned his age as a contributing factor, as he wanted to confront his own personal growth as an actor. Harmon expressed pride in his involvement with the show and recognized the team’s commitment to their craft.

Although Harmon’s presence remained in the opening credits until Season 20, he has not taken on any new acting roles since leaving NCIS.

However, his recent signing with The Gersh Agency suggests potential future endeavors in the acting sphere. Harmon’s departure marked a significant transition for both the character and the actor, signaling a new chapter in their respective journeys.

Is Mark Harmon Coming Back to NCIS?

Mark Harmon’s potential comeback to NCIS lingers in the realm of possibility, according to hints and statements from those involved in the show.

In an interview with TV Insider, Rocky Carroll, who portrays NCIS Director Leon Vance, suggested that Gibbs (played by Harmon) could return as long as the show continues.

Carroll compared Gibbs to Gary Cooper’s iconic character in “High Noon,” describing him as the moral compass we all yearn for.

Harmon himself hinted at a future return in a featurette for the NCIS Season 19 DVD, stating that Gibbs was written out of the show in a way that doesn’t imply his demise, leaving the door open for a potential comeback.

Executive producer and showrunner Steven D. Binder also fueled speculation in a statement to Entertainment Tonight, emphasizing Harmon’s importance to the show and stating, “Never count Leroy Jethro Gibbs out.”

Executive producer Chase Floyd Johnson confirmed that Harmon approved of Gibbs’ departure and praised the unique path taken by the character.

The final scene, where Gibbs is left in a state of contentment, adds an intriguing layer to his departure, with no definitive statement that he will never return.

While the return of Mark Harmon as Gibbs to NCIS remains uncertain, the hints and statements suggest that the possibility has not been ruled out. Fans may have the opportunity to witness Gibbs’ unwavering moral compass in action once again in the future.
